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A stowage bin assembly is configured to be positioned above at least a portion of one or more seats within a vehicle. The stowage bin assembly may include a pivot bin including a forward end panel, an aft end panel that is opposed to the forward end panel, a front panel extending between the forward and aft end panels, and a closeout bracket secured to the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el. A baggage retaining chamber is defined between the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el. The closeout bracket spans between the forward end panel and the aft end panel.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1 . A stowage bin assembly configured to be positioned above at least a portion of one or more seats within a vehicle, the stowage bin assembly comprising: a pivot bin including: a forward end panel; an aft end panel that is opposed to the forward end panel; a front panel extending between the forward and aft end panels, wherein a baggage retaining chamber is defined between the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el; and a closeout bracket that stiffens the pivot bin, wherein the closeout bracket extends along an edge of the front panel between the forward end panel and the aft end panel. 2 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 1 , further comprising a strongback, wherein the pivot bin is pivotally secured to the strongback, and wherein the pivot bin is configured to be pivoted between open and closed positions. 3 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 1 , wherein the stowage bin assembly is devoid of an upper panel. 4 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 1 , wherein the closeout bracket is secured to a bottom end of the front panel. 5 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 4 , wherein no portion of any panel extends past the closeout bracket between the forward and aft end panel. 6 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 1 , wherein each of the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el are formed of composite honeycomb sandwich panels, and wherein the closeout bracket is formed from a unitary piece of metal. 7 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 1 , wherein the baggage retaining chamber is configured to support standard sized roller bags in a vertically-oriented position in open and closed positions, wherein an interior surface of the front panel is configured to support sides of the standard sized roller bags in the open and closed positions. 8 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 1 , wherein the closeout bracket comprises a closeout flange that is configured to be spaced apart from a strongback through an entire range of motion of the pivot bin with respect to the strongback. 9 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 8 , wherein the closeout flange comprises an upturned edge of a longitudinal main body. 10 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 8 , wherein the closeout bracket comprises a main body having a first portion connected to a second portion through an intermediate curved portion, wherein the main body is configured to cradle lower curved corner portions of the forward and aft end panels. 11 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 10 , wherein the closeout bracket further comprises one or more securing tabs extending perpendicularly from one or both of the first and second portions, wherein each of the one or more securing tabs comprises a through-hole configured to receive a fastener that secures the closeout bracket to one or more of the front panel, the forward end panel, or the aft end panel. 12 . A method of forming a pivot bin of a stowage bin assembly that is configured to be positioned above at least a portion of one or more seats within a vehicle, the method comprising: forming a forward end panel, an aft end panel, and a front panel; aligning the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el with respect to a closeout bracket; and attaching the closeout bracket along an edge of the front panel between the forward end panel and the aft end panel. 13 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the aligning operation comprises using the closeout bracket as an assembly jig for the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el. 14 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the attaching operation comprises one or both of adhesively securing the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el to the closeout bracket or using one or more fasteners to secure the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el to the closeout bracket. 15 . The method of claim 12 , further comprising upturning an edge of the closeout bracket to form a closeout flange. 16 . The method of claim 12 , further comprising refraining from securing an upper panel to any of the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el. 17 . The method of claim 12 , further comprising refraining from folding any panel portions to form any of the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el. 18 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the forming operation comprises forming the front panel with a different thickness than the forward and aft end panels. 19 . A stowage bin assembly configured to be positioned above at least a portion of one or more seats within a vehicle, the stowage bin assembly comprising: a pivot bin including a closeout bracket that stiffens the pivot bin, wherein the closeout bracket extends along an edge of a front panel between a forward end panel and an aft end panel. 20 . The stowage bin assembly of claim 19 , wherein a baggage retaining chamber is defined between the forward end panel, the aft end panel, and the front panel, wherein the baggage retaining chamber is configured to support standard sized roller bags in a vertically-oriented position in open and closed positions, wherein an interior surface of the front panel is configured to support sides of the standard sized roller bags in the open and closed positions.
